Responsibilities
SIGN ON AND RELOCATION BENEFITS AVAILABLE TO QUALIFIED CANDIDATES

Sign on and relocation benefits available to qualified candidates!

Responsible for utilizing the nursing process to provide direct patient care to an assigned group of patients during a shift.

Other Duties
  • Responsible for prioritizing the delivery of direct nursing care using time and resources efficiently integrating a standards-based framework model
  • Provides direct patient care by assessing, planning, implementing, evaluating, and documenting individual patient needs, actions taken and patient responses.
  • Coordinates patients care through collaboration with the patient/family and healthcare team.
  • Performs assessments as per unit standards and documents on appropriate data base/assessment flow sheet.
  • Initiates, utilizes and documents appropriate protocols and standards of care.
  • Administers medication and treatments as prescribed by physician, or protocols and documents according to policy.
  • Identifies and meets patient and family learning and discharge needs on admission and throughout episode of care.
  • Evaluates patient progression toward outcomes per unit policies and documents through EOSS etc.
  • Performs competently in emergency situations.
  • Delegates or assigns aspects of patient care to healthcare team members commensurate with their validated competency to perform the task.
  • Assumes responsibility for the clinical supervision of LPNs and non-licensed assistive personnel.
  • Provides leadership through communication about and validation of patient care.
  • Assists with various procedures, treatments, surgical techniques or assigns to other healthcare team members as appropriate.
  • Completes patient population/age-specific/procedure and protocol education and competency testing per unit policy.
  • Demonstrates competency in required psychomotor skills.
  • Assists in orientation of new staff or students and serve as a resource person and professional role model.
  • Assumes professional responsibility for current nursing structure, nursing guidelines of care, and policies.
  • Incorporates PHS mission (VVPS) in care-giving activities.
  • Supports DON philosophies of professional governance and models of care delivery.
  • Assumes other leadership roles (i.e. relief charge nurse) as required by the department.

About Presbyterian Healthcare Services

Learn more about our employee benefits.

Presbyterian exists to improve the health of patients, members, and the communities we serve. We are locally owned, not-for-profit healthcare system of nine hospitals, a statewide health plan and a growing multi-specialty medical group. Founded in New Mexico in 1908, we are the state's largest private employer with nearly 14,000 employees - including more than 1600 providers and nearly 4,700 nurses.

Our health plan serves more than 580,000 members statewide and offers Medicare Advantage, Medicaid (Centennial Care) and Commercial health plans.
